[1J02] Evaluation of FP Behavior Models for SAs

(2)Evaluation of aerosol formation and growth models in SA codes

*Hidetoshi Karasawa1, Shuuhei Miwa1, Chiaki Kino2 (1. JAEA, 2. IAE)

Keywords:aerosol, SAPSON code, SA, condensation, agglomeration, Phebus-FPT1 test

It was found that aerosol was aggregates of fine particles with diameters of less than 200 nm and the weight distribution was independent of the diameter in the Phebus-FP experiments. To explain these findings, the formation of primary particles consisting of several FP fine particles was proposed. This time, the formation model of the primary particles was installed in the SAMPSON code. The model is that monomers are formed from the supersaturated vapor of FPs by nucleation and condensation and grow to the primary particle by agglomeration in a reactor core. The Phebus FPT1 test analysis using the SAMPSON code was done to check the applicability of this model.
